Cardiff City boss Brian Barry-Murphy's three-word response to Strasbourg job links
By Glen Williams

Brian Barry-Murphy has played down links with Strasbourg amid yet more reports that suitors are interested in prising the Cardiff City boss away from the fantastic job he is overseeing in the Welsh capital.

Barry-Murphy oversaw yet another victory in front of a home crowd, their eighth home win in a row which is their best return since 2012, to maintain a three-point lead at the top of League One.

The impressive job he has done at Cardiff has seen him linked with the likes of Middlesbrough and Celtic in recent months, while there was also tentative talk of him potentially being recruited by Strasbourg should Liam Rosenior leave.

Rosenior is thought to be the leading candidate to replace Enzo Maresca at Chelsea, which would leave the French side in need of a new boss. However, when quizzed on those Strasbourg links, Barry-Murphy simply replied: "I love Cardiff." :bluebird: :bluescarf: :ayatollah:

That sort of response will no doubt delight owner Vincent Tan - and it's not the only aspect of the day which will put a smile on the Malaysian's face.
